Description of Change
If WiFi has been started via Arduino API, but the WiFi scan is started via IDF API,
WiFiScanClass::_scanDone
is still called fromthe event callback and reads out the scan result.
Test Scenarios
Arduino-esp32 core v 3.2.1, ESP32-C3
